Auto Attendant Delay

Discussion in '3CX Phone System - General' started by Anonymous, Apr 2, 2007.

  1. Anonymous

    Anonymous Guest


    I am currently experiencing a problem with my Auto Attendant / Digital Receptionist. When someone calls into the system, 3CX picks up the call (as shown in the log file) but then there is a 3 to 5 second delay before the digital recptionist starts to play the WAV file.?

    If I restart the IVR service, it seems to shorten the delay signifigantly, however that doesn't last long as I will have to restart it again before the business day is over.

    Any clues or suggestions?

    Thanks in advance.
  2. Anonymous

    Anonymous Guest

    Could be a range of things mate,

    When you restart you say it is considerably better, so it is possible not your 3cx config (would not rule it out though) here are some pointers (you might know them already).

    - QoS as time goes on you network (in particular switches and network cards) might get congested by trying to retransmit "lost" packages. You might have a"dodgy" network card or driver, perhaps even the cabling.
    - Proxy/cache 3cx runs on apache so I am not sure if the mediaserver actually makes use of proxy/cache could be but not sure. So everytime your IVR plays it might try to resolve the proxy first before giving up and than going for the media file.
    - Memory (good old memory) do you know if your system memory hogs? Especially 3CX i have not looked at it but it might be the case.
    - Log files, every message/error is logged by 3CX it does not look like there is any maximum for the logging but the files can get very big (my biggest so far is 4.5GB (kid you not)) it might be that it takes 3CX longer to find the EOF to write the new line as the files get bigger. Perhaps they are taking the memory. You got the SPA400 and we did some "tricks" to make that work so I will not be surprised if the logs fill up. The logs is something that 3CX has to fix in my opinion they should not be allowed to get that big but that is just my opinion.

    I think your issue might be a performance degradation especially if your performance decreases as the day goes on.

    Hope this helps.

  3. Anonymous

    Anonymous Guest

    Thanks for the insight.

    I think it may be a memory issue because after reading your last post, I checked the Task Manager and the MSSQLSvr.exe task was hogging over a Gig of memory. I restarted the service and the prompt started playing without a delay again. Before I was restarting 3CX services to solve the issue and this time I didn't touch any of those services.

    So I think I may have stumbled on root of the problem I guess.

    Does 3CX use a MYSQL backend or will it use the full SQL Server it it is already installed on the machine?

  4. Nick Galea

    Nick Galea Site Admin

    Jun 6, 2006
    Likes Received:
    Hi Brian

    In response to your question - it uses Postgres, not microsoft SQL server neither MySQL. The name of the service escapes me now, but its description is 3CX Database server...

    Well double check the issue mentioned in this post
